Monsanto Statement on rescheduling the final approval hearing

On August 6, 2026, the Missouri Circuit Court overseeing the Roundup™ class settlement granted the joint motion by Monsanto and Class Counsel and rescheduled the final approval hearing for September 14. The company’s statement:

“The Court’s order is a positive development as it will give the parties and the Class Administrator approximately three additional weeks to process opt-out revocation requests that have been received by the Administrator following the Supreme Court’s recent Durnell decision, and to resolve opt-out invalidity challenges as quickly as possible.”

 

As previously communicated, the company is confident that the class settlement, which is supported by plaintiffs’ counsel representing tens of thousands of potential class members, is fair to all parties and warrants final approval.
